Ghoul Agency Volume 1 The Dagmar TP – Action Lab Entertainment unleashes a horror comedy for readers of all ages! Shay Melendez is a hard working creative for a unique advertising agency. The Ghoul Agency caters to special clientele ranging from mad scientists to creatures of the night. When she isn’t recovering accounts nearly fumbled by her literal demon of a boss and meeting with the agency’s Lovecraftian H.R. managers, Shay is thwarting the attempts at corporate espionage by rival agency, Crast-Pritcher Universal, or CPU, which may or may not be staffed by robots bent on taking over the world. Just another day at the office. With a great lead, and plenty of light-hearted comedy and action, this title is sure to entertain!

Tales Of Great Goddesses Gaia Goddess Of Earth GN – Amulet Books continues their Tales of Great Goddesses. Gaia, the Earth goddess, created the world in all its beauty, and filled it with life. Their children, the Titans, ran wild and free, until her husband Ouranos turned on Gaia and declared himself ruler of all she’d created. After helping her son Cronus, and then her grandson Zeus defeat their fathers, she found she no longer wanted to be part of their world. Watch Gaia as she struggles with gods and mortals, discovering her strength and eventually finding the peace she has always longed for. While always apart of the tales of the Olympian gods, this title finally gives the goddess of the earth the attention she deserves. Fans of Greek mythology will not want to miss it!
